Assessment of Coronary Artery Calcium in Active Duty Enlisted Military Members With 10 or More Years of Service

Stopped early

Conditions studied: Atherosclerosis, Plaque, Atherosclerotic

In brief

Hypothesis: Enlisted military members with 10 or more years of service and at least one cardiovascular risk factor will demonstrate a higher risk of future cardiac events as assessed by coronary artery calcium (CAC) scoring than the risk calculated by the Framingham Risk Score.
